Hello Sir/mam, If you suspect that your phone may be compromised or hacked, here are some steps you can take to check and address the issue:
1:- Unusual Behavior:
Pay attention to any unusual behavior on your phone, such as unexpected pop-ups, battery drainage, or increased data usage.
2:- Check for Strange Apps:
Review the list of installed apps on your phone. If you find any unfamiliar or suspicious apps, uninstall them immediately.
3:- Update Software:
Ensure that your phone’s operating system and all apps are up to date. Software updates often include security patches.
4:- Run Security Software:
Install and run reputable antivirus or anti-malware software on your phone to scan for and remove any potential threats.
5:- Review App Permissions:
Check the permissions granted to each app on your phone. If an app has unnecessary or suspicious permissions, consider revoking them.
6:-Check Account Activity:
Review the activity on your email, social media, and other accounts linked to your phone. Look for any unauthorized access or changes.
7:-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A):
Enable 2FA for your important accounts to add an extra layer of security.
8:-Secure Your Passwords:
Change passwords for your accounts, especially if you suspect unauthorized access. Use strong, unique passwords for each account.
9:-Disconnect from Networks:
If you suspect your phone is compromised, disconnect from Wi-Fi and mobile data to prevent unauthorized access.
10:- Factory Reset:
As a last resort, if you cannot identify or resolve the issue, consider performing a factory reset on your phone. This will erase all data, so make sure to back up important information first.
Seek Professional Help:
If you’re unsure or unable to resolve the issue on your own, consider seeking help from a professional or contacting your device’s customer support.

Dear Sir/mam, In a quick check it seems riskier in dealing with them, especially where money is involved. The reasons are given Below:-
1:- Similar designs and platforms were overserved earlier who were convicted in fraud.
2:- No Real information related to the owners of the platform is in the public domain, which means you will never get to know with whom you are dealing.
3:- On the website, the information provided is wrong. The address of the business does not belong to them.
They target victims in multiple ways, one of the approaches they use is, they will ask you to buy stocks or crypto currencies from their platforms. It’s like you do not buy stocks actually, it’s just like you transfer money from your account to their account and they show you that you have purchased the stocks. Later when you try to sell the stocks or want to withdraw. They will ask you to pay money for withdrawal as fees.
Suggestions:- Avoid using such untrusted platforms especially those who make false promises of higher returns. You may lose a big amount in seeking profits.

It’s highly likely that you are being targeted in a scam. The scenario you described, where someone asks you to pay custom duty and courier charges upon receiving an item, is a common red flag for scams. Legitimate sellers and businesses typically handle such charges during the purchase process, and it’s unusual for the recipient to pay these fees directly to the courier.
Here’s what you should consider doing:
1:- Do Not Pay Anything:
Do not make any payments for custom duty or courier charges or any kind of payment they ask for. Scammers often use these tactics to extract money from victims.
2:- Cease Communication:
Stop communicating with the individual immediately. Do not provide any additional personal information.
3:-Check Your Accounts:
Monitor your bank accounts and other financial information closely for any unauthorized transactions. If you provided sensitive information like credit card details, be vigilant for potential fraud.
4:- Report the Incident:
Report the incident to your local law enforcement agency and provide them with all the details you have.
5:- Inform Your Bank:
If you shared any banking information, contact your bank to inform them of the situation. They can guide you on steps to take to secure your account.
6:- Change Passwords:
If you shared passwords or login credentials, change them immediately to prevent unauthorized access to your accounts.
7:- Educate Yourself:
Learn from this experience and be cautious in the future about sharing personal information online, especially with unknown individuals.
8:-Report to Platform:
If the communication occurred on a specific online platform or social media, report the user and provide details about the attempted scam.
Remember, scammers often try to create a sense of urgency to pressure individuals into making quick decisions. It’s crucial to remain calm, take the necessary precautions, and seek help from the appropriate authorities. Receiving messages from unknown numbers about job opportunities can be risky, as there are many scams and fraudulent schemes out there. Exercise caution and consider the following before responding:
1:- Verify the Company: Do some research on the company mentioned in the message. Check if they have a legitimate website, contact information, and reviews. Be cautious if the company is not well-known or if there is limited information available.
2:- Avoid Personal Information: Never share personal or sensitive information such as your address, social security number, or financial details without thorough verification of the legitimacy of the opportunity.
3:- Google the Offer: Search for the specific job offer or company online. Scams are often reported by others, and you may find warnings or information that can help you assess the credibility of the offer.
4:- Trust Your Instincts: If something feels off or too good to be true, it probably is. Be wary of offers that promise high pay for minimal effort or request an upfront payment.
5:- Ask for Details Safely: If you decide to inquire further, ask for details about the job without revealing personal information. Request information about the nature of the work, expectations, and how payment is processed.
6:- Avoid Clicking on Links: Be cautious about clicking on any links provided in the message, as they may lead to malicious websites. Instead, try to find information independently.
7:- Consult with Others: If possible, discuss the offer with friends, family, or colleagues. They may provide additional perspectives and help you make an informed decision.
Final suggestion :- it’s advisable to avoid engaging further with the unknown message, block the phone number and do not fall in such trap.
